Top Exercises for People with a Higher Body Weight
Low-impact exercises are generally considered to be the best options for obese individuals, as they minimize the risk of injury and place less stress on joints. Some examples include:
- Walking: Start with short distances and gradually increase the duration and pace as your fitness level improves.
- Swimming: Swimming and water aerobics provide a low-impact, full-body workout while the water buoyancy helps support your body weight.
- Cycling: Stationary bikes or outdoor cycling can be a good option, as it puts less pressure on the joints compared to weight-bearing exercises.
- Chair exercises: Seated workouts can help build strength and flexibility while minimizing the risk of injury.
- Yoga or Tai Chi: These gentle practices can help improve flexibility, balance, and strength while promoting relaxation and stress reduction.
Remember that consistency and gradual progression are key to success in any exercise program. It’s essential to listen to your body, start slowly, and gradually increase the intensity and duration of your workouts. Pairing regular physical activity with a healthy diet and lifestyle changes can help you reach your weight loss and fitness goals.
Great Exercise for Overweight and Obese Beginners: Walking Towards Health
Walking is a fantastic low-impact exercise for overweight and obese beginners. It’s easy to start, doesn’t require any special equipment, and can be done anywhere. Start with short walks and gradually increase the duration and intensity as your fitness level improves. Walking helps improve cardiovascular health, increase endurance, and burn calories.
Group Exercises for People With Bad Knees: Workouts for Obese Beginners
Low-impact group exercises like water aerobics, seated cycling, and chair yoga are ideal for people with bad knees. These workouts minimize stress on the joints while still providing a great workout for obese beginners. Participating in group classes can also provide motivation, support, and accountability on your fitness journey.

15-Minute Lose Weight Routine: Effective Workout for Obese Beginners | Group Exercise
An effective 15-minute workout for obese beginners could include a combination of low-impact cardiovascular exercises and strength training. Try a workout that includes 5 minutes of marching in place, followed by two sets of 10 modified push-ups, two sets of 10 seated leg lifts, and finishing with 5 minutes of gentle stretching.
Bed Exercises for Morbidly Obese Individuals: Gentle Body Lifting and Fitness
Bed exercises can be a gentle way for morbidly obese individuals to start their fitness journey. Some effective exercises include leg lifts, arm circles, seated marches, and ankle pumps. These exercises help increase circulation, improve muscle strength, and promote overall health. Make sure to consult with a healthcare professional or a certified trainer before starting any exercise program to ensure it’s safe and appropriate for your specific needs.
